echo 'Following are the different random values within ranges min and max'; // program to generate random integer value ALL RIGHTS RESERVED. Adding in Simple Code. Here are some examples of PHP code that's used to generate a random unique user ID. How to see Instagram follow requests that you’ve sent. So let us know how this function is used. If no max limit is specified when using the rand() PHP function, the largest integer that can be returned is determined by the getrandmax() function, which varies by operating system. rand(1,100); // program to generate random integer value Floating-point numbers represent a number with decimals that are of the type float. It is particularly used to store product-related data like price, code, manufacturing date, and similar data. Example: How to Get Visa credit card number. echo '
'; Definition and Usage. In this article, we’ll see how to generate a very simple and effective Captcha Image in PHP. \$number = rand (\$min, \$max); //Print the result echo \$number; 1. Let’s take a look at one of the simplest examples: PHP. echo '
'; mt_rand(100000,999999); This is the inbuild function of a php, you can generate a random number of 6 digit through it. '; This is a short guide on how to generate a random number using PHP. echo 'Program to display floating point numbers '; Sometimes the phone number is real by accident. echo 'random number using mt_getrandmax() function'; If we wanted a number between 1 and 10, then we’d simply change our \$min variable to 1, as \$min represents the lowest value that the rand function should return. The numbers get shuffled within the range and are generated accordingly. This function provides the range to the rand() function. echo '
Range 5 to 25 ---->'. Next, we simply have to use this library to create the QR code. echo '
Range 9 to 19 --->'. You may also look at the following articles to learn more –. © 2020 - EDUCBA. A number which is only divisible by 1 and itself is called prime number. rand(); ".fun(1, 10, 2); Barcode is a machine-readable ident bundled with data about an entity. How to clear your Facebook app cache on Android. where min is optional value and denotes the lowest number and max is optional value and denotes the highest number. 2 is the only even prime number. There are many ways to generate a random, unique, alphanumeric string in PHP which are given below: Using str_shuffle() Function: The str_shuffle() function is an inbuilt function in PHP and is used to randomly shuffle all the characters of a string passed to the function as a parameter. If you are looking for a QR code […] Generate up to 999 worth of Visa cards with complete fake details. The default value of min is 0 and the default value of max is the given highest value. generate random numbers in php with no repeats. ?>. If you need a random number that is cryptographically secure, then you have two choices. Since 7.1. onward, rand has become an alias of mt_rand. echo '
'; With Mastercard credit card generator tool, you can create new mastercard numbers for testing and simulation purposes.All Mastercard's generating by the luhn algorithm. For example, if you have 10 people that you need to have randomly lined up, you can assign each a number and then generate a list of random numbers for all ten in the numbers generator. \$min = 0; //The max / highest number. echo '
'; echo 'Following are the different random values using mt_rand() '; THE CERTIFICATION NAMES ARE THE TRADEMARKS OF THEIR RESPECTIVE OWNERS. PHP has another function that generates random numbers: mt_rand().It works similarly to (but, arguably, better than) rand() and is the smarter choice for sensitive situations like cryptography. Get Five Digits Random Number Using Javascript, 5 Digits Number Generate in javascript code, How to Find Five Digits Random Number with Javascript, Create 5 Digits Random Number Using Javascript. So what is random number generator? mt_rand(9, 19); '; where min is the optional minimum value and denotes the lowest number value and max is the optional maximum value and denotes the highest numerical value. In the next example, we will use the function mt_rand instead of rand: The mt_rand function is superior to rand because it uses a better randomization algorithm (Mersenne Twister Random Number Generator). echo '
Using mt_rand()---->'. rand(10000, 50000); echo '
'. echo '
'; Hardware based random-number generators can involve the use of a dice, a coin for flipping, or many other devices. echo '
'; echo(mt_getrandmax()); PDO: Get the ID of the last inserted row. echo 'Random number using getrandmax() function'; echo '
'; echo 'example using srand'; Generating useful random data is a fairly common task for a developer to implement, but also one that developers rarely get right. '; If we wanted a number between 1 and 100, then we’d change \$min to 1 and \$max to 100. Generate a Random Number for a PIN. The return type is an integer. Prime number in PHP. The getrandmax() function returns the largest possible random number that can be created using rand().This value differs by operating system. You can now easily Generate visa credit card numbers complete with fake details such as name, address, expiration date and security details such as the 3-digit security code or CVV and CVV2. We can generate random numbers or integers using built-in functions. echo 'example using srand'; echo '
'; Random number generators can be hardware based or pseudo-random number generators. srand(2); ?>. This means that if you call the rand function, you will really be calling the mt_rand function. \$max = 10; //Generate a random number using the rand function. Or is it by design? This PHP code generator is both responsive and web-based, so you can generate code from a PC or smartphone browser. echo '
'. rand(); echo '
'. In the example above, we are generating a random number between 1 and 1000. Much easier way to generate random string of numbers and letters: This generates strings of about 11 characters. ?>, Using mt_rand()---->'. Let’s take a look at one of the simplest examples: In the code sample above, we used PHP’s rand function to generate a random number between 0 and 10. ?>, . If you want random number sets with duplicates allowed try the Random Number and Letter Set Generator. Captchas are smart (at least most of the time) verification systems that prevent sites from bots that steals data from the site or unnecessarily increases the traffic of the site. ?>, '; echo mt_rand(1,5); Examples – 10.0, 8.12, 6.23e-5, 2.345, 2.98e+10 and more. ?>. // random number with range A unique user ID can be created in PHP using the uniqid function. Where the seed is an optional value, and this function does not return anything. Start Your Free Software Development Course, Web development, programming languages, Software testing & others. Adding Two Numbers. rand(); rand(5, 25); This program is intended for developers who are studying credit or debit cards algorithms, and persons who want to test their own working credit card numbers. It is important to note that the rand function is not cryptographically secure and that it should not be used in any important security features. echo '
Range : 1 to 100 ----> '. The top number generated would place the person assigned the first spot to that place with the other people in the group moved to the appropriate places from there. echo 'Following are the different random values using mt_rand()'; Here we discuss the different functions of random number generator in php along with its examples. ?>. I used the tc-lib-barcode library for creating barcodes using PHP. Facebook: Who are “Featured Viewers” and “Others” on Featured Stories? This website or its third-party tools use cookies, which are necessary to its functioning and required to achieve the purposes illustrated in the cookie policy. echo '
'. And every time you call this function it will generate a number that is unique. To generate a random number between 1 and 100, do the same, but with 100 in the second field of the picker. The rand() function is used in PHP to generate a random integer. There are various built-in functions to generate random numbers. rand(); Tip: The mt_rand () function produces a better random value, and is 4 times faster than rand (). require "vendor/autoload.php"; // program to generate random integer value using mt_srand() function In this article, we will be learning about a random number generator in PHP. echo(getrandmax()); Thanks guys for ur help… I think u dont understand my q… its simple, For example i want to store this in db:(0107001) here 01 is month,07 is date,001 is number(but it increments on each insertion Prime Number. //The minimum / lowest number. Generate valid debit and free credit card numbers from banks worldwide or create your own pattern (BIN code). Generating Random Numbers in PHP. echo '
'. Pretty simple, right? If you want to generate a unique number within a range, then define the start and end point of random number. all the numbers generated are fake, but they could be verified. Now we will be learning about different functions that generate pseudo-random numbers: We will learn the syntax followed by the examples of each type of function mentioned. mt_rand(1000,9999); If you have any questions, comments or suggestions please About US. When a number is passed, it treats the number as the string and shuffles it. //using mt_getrandmax() function echo(rand(1, 5)); echo '
Any random number within the range from 1000  to 9999 ---->'. Hope this article is found useful to anyone who wants to learn a random number generator in PHP. // program to generate random integer value echo '
Any random number ---->'. An easy way is to use Composer to pull it – composer require endroid/qr-code. Recommended Articles. Possible bug? You can use this random number generator to pick a truly random number between any two numbers. echo '
'; These functions within a range of min and max generate different sets of numbers. There are three different functions for generating random numbers in PHP. Underscore should be between to numbers.No Space there between number The rand() function generates a random integer. //Generate a random number using the rand function. echo '
Range : 1 to 100 ----> '. To simulate a dice roll, the range should be 1 to 6 for a standard six-sided dice.T… The third example creates an ID with a random number as the prefix while the last line can be used to encrypt the username before storing it. What do these functions do? Tips. echo '